  • How Much Can You Lose From Liposuction In Hamilton

    Asked by Liam Gutierrez, 2024-10-18 14:04:45
    3 Answers

    Liposuction in Hamilton offers a transformative solution for individuals seeking to eliminate stubborn fat deposits that resist traditional diet and exercise. The amount of fat that can be safely removed during a liposuction procedure varies based on several factors, including the patient's overall health, the specific areas targeted, and the surgeon's expertise.

    Typically, the procedure can remove between 5 to 10 pounds of fat, though in some cases, more significant amounts can be addressed, especially when multiple areas are treated simultaneously. However, it's important to note that liposuction is not a weight-loss solution but rather a contouring procedure aimed at enhancing body shape and proportion.

    Surgeons in Hamilton adhere to strict safety guidelines to ensure optimal results and patient well-being. The goal is to achieve a natural-looking outcome that aligns with the patient's aesthetic goals, rather than focusing solely on the quantity of fat removed.

    Before undergoing liposuction, it's crucial to have a detailed consultation with a qualified plastic surgeon to discuss your expectations and the realistic outcomes. This will help you understand how much fat can be safely removed and what you can expect post-procedure in terms of recovery and results.

    Understanding Liposuction Results

    When considering liposuction in Hamilton, it's important to have realistic expectations about the results. Liposuction is a surgical procedure designed to remove excess fat from specific areas of the body, but the amount of fat removed can vary significantly from person to person. On average, patients can expect to lose between 5 to 10 pounds of fat through liposuction. However, individual outcomes depend on several factors, including the patient's body composition, the areas targeted for treatment, and the skill of the surgeon.

    Factors Influencing Liposuction Outcomes

    Several factors can influence the amount of fat removed during liposuction:

    1. Body Composition: Individuals with a higher percentage of body fat may see more significant results compared to those with lower body fat percentages.
    2. Target Areas: The amount of fat that can be safely removed from different body areas varies. For instance, more fat can be removed from the abdomen compared to the face.
    3. Surgeon's Expertise: The skill and experience of the surgeon play a crucial role in the outcome. A highly skilled surgeon will be able to remove fat more effectively and ensure a smoother, more natural-looking result.

    Safety Considerations

    While it's tempting to aim for a larger amount of fat removal, it's important to prioritize safety. Removing too much fat in one session can increase the risk of complications such as skin irregularities, fluid imbalance, and prolonged recovery times. Therefore, surgeons typically adhere to safe limits to ensure the best possible outcome with minimal risk.

    Post-Procedure Expectations

    After liposuction, patients can expect some swelling and bruising, which can affect the immediate results. Over time, as the body heals, the final results will become more apparent. It's also important to maintain a healthy lifestyle to preserve the results of liposuction. Regular exercise and a balanced diet can help maintain the new body contour and prevent the return of fat in the treated areas.
